It was nominated for two Academy Awards, two BAFTA Awards and three Golden Globe Awards. The film grossed over $227 million dollars worldwide. The American Film Institute (AFI) lists "Sleepless in Seattle" among the Top 10 Best Romantic Comedies of all time. According to Playhouse notes, " Sleepless in Seattle - The Musical centers around Sam, a widower and single father. The creative team includes choreographer Spencer Liff (The Playhouse's A Snow White Christmas, "So You Think You Can Dance"), scenic designer John Iacovelli (The Playhouse's The Heiress, Art and Blues for an Alabama Sky), lighting and projection designer Brian Gale (The Playhouse's Intimate Apparel and The Heiress), sound designer Carl Casella ( One Night With Janis Joplin), costume designer Kate Bergh (The Playhouse's Under My Skin), music supervisor Tony nominee Larry Blank ( Catch Me If You Can, The Drowsy Chaperone, Irving Berlin's White Christmas), musical director David O and orchestrator Tony winner Michael Starobin ( Next to Normal, Assassins). It's based on the Columbia Pictures film that starred Tom Hanks and Meg Ryan. Sleepless in Seattle has a book by Jeff Arch, music by Ben Toth and lyrics by Sam Forman. Rounding out the ensemble are Sachin Bhatt ( Bombay Dreams), Terron Brooks ("The Temptations," The Lion King), Jay Donnell ("Joshua Tree, 1951: A Portrait of James Dean"), Charissa Hogeland, Teya Patt ("Weeds") and Yuka Takara ( A Chorus Line, Rent, Flower Drum Song). The cast includes Gleason ( The Phantom of the Opera) as Sam, West ( A Christmas Story) as Jonah, Schwartz ( Wicked, Gypsy) as Annie, Sabrina Sloan ("American Idol," Catch Me if You Can) as Becky, Todd Buonopane ("30 Rock," Happy Days) as Rob, Cynthia Ferrer ("General Hospital," "Georgia Rule") as Eleanor, Katharine Leonard ( Hairspray) as Victoria, Robert Mammana ( Les Misérables, "Dexter") as Walter, Adam Silver ("Californication," "The Runaways") as Greg, Lowe Taylor ( The Marvelous Wondrettes) as Suzy and Carter Thomas ( Mary Poppins national tour) as Jonah alternate. Sheldon Epps ( Baby It's You!, Play On! and Blues in the Night), artistic director of Pasadena Playhouse, directs the production, which continues through June 23. The romantic musical based on the hit film began previews May 24.
